Patents Assigned to Dr. Johannes Heidenhain GnbH
  • Patent number: 7274464
    Abstract: A position measuring device for detecting the spatial position of a movable element in relation to a base body, the device including a linear measuring device that measures a distance between a movable element and a base body and an angle-measuring apparatus that measures an angle between the movable element and the base body. A light source that directs light along a beam path, a detector within the beam path and a grating within the beam path between the light source and the detector. For measuring the angle, the beam path extends between the movable element and the base body so that an intensity strip pattern is created by illuminating the grating by the light source, whose position relative to the detector is a measure of the angle.
